All three branches CSE, Petroleum and Aeronautical Engineering are equally good. As per current trend CSE is the most preferred branch. However with increasing out cry against outsourcing charm of Software Industry in India is slowly fading. But still as of now, it is the most sought after branch of engineering. Aeronautical and Petroleum are niche branches with comparitive lesser career options . But both very interesting branches with lots of innovation & research potential.
